Inleiding: Wat is 'n rakperd?

The Racking Horse is a breed of horse that is known for its unique and smooth gait. This breed originated in the southern United States and is popular among horse enthusiasts for its versatility and beauty. Racking Horses are often used for trail riding, showing, and pleasure riding.

Fisiese kenmerke van die rakperd

The Racking Horse is a medium-sized horse that typically stands between 14 and 16 hands tall. They have a muscular build with a short back and a sloping shoulder. Their head is small and refined with large, expressive eyes. Racking Horses are known for their graceful and elegant appearance.

Gait: The Racking Horse’s Smooth Ride

The Racking Horse’s unique gait is what sets it apart from other breeds. They have a four-beat gait that is smooth and easy to ride. This gait is known as the "single-foot" and is often described as a gliding motion. The Racking Horse’s gait is comfortable for riders and allows them to cover long distances without experiencing the bouncing and jarring that can occur with other gaits.

History of the Racking Horse Breed

The Racking Horse is a relatively new breed, with a history that dates back to the early 1900s. This breed was developed in the southern United States as a versatile riding horse that could cover long distances over rough terrain. Racking Horses were originally bred from a mix of breeds, including Tennessee Walking Horses and American Saddlebreds.

The Racking Horse’s Coat Colors and Patterns

Racking Horses come in a variety of coat colors and patterns, including black, bay, chestnut, and palomino. They can also have unique patterns such as roan, sabino, and tobiano. The Racking Horse’s coat is often shiny and lustrous, adding to their overall beauty and elegance.

Racking Horse Associations and Organizations

There are several associations and organizations dedicated to the Racking Horse breed, including the Racking Horse Breeders’ Association of America and the Tennessee Walking Horse Breeders’ and Exhibitors’ Association. These groups provide resources and support for Racking Horse owners and breeders, as well as opportunities for showing and competition.
